The Great TCS Salary Hike Deferment of 2025

Here’s what happened: TCS initially announced annual salary hikes during Q3FY25 results, with increments ranging from 4% to 8%, effective March 2025 and payments starting in April. However, in a surprising move, TCS deferred salary increases for 2025 that were initially anticipated to start in April, blaming the decision on concerns about tariffs and the state of the world economy brought up by US President Donald Trump.
Why the delay? The company cited several factors:
- Global economic uncertainty
- US tariff concerns under the new administration
- Project delays and reduced client spending
- Market volatility affecting IT services demand
But here’s the silver lining: TCS announced salary revisions for all eligible associates in grades up to C3A, covering around 80% of its workforce, effective September 1, 2025.

Understanding TCS Salary Structure: A Grade-wise Breakdown
Before we dive deeper into TCS salary specifics, let’s understand the company’s hierarchical structure. The TCS grade system includes: Y (ASE-T – Assistant Systems Engineer Trainee), C1Y (ASE – Assistant Systems Engineer with 0-2 years experience), C1 (SE – Systems Engineer with 2-4 years experience), C2 (ITA – IT Analyst with 4-7 years experience), and C3A (AST – Assistant Consultant with 7-10 years experience).
Detailed Grade Structure and Salary Ranges
Grade | Designation | Experience | Average Salary Range (LPA) |
---|---|---|---|
Y | ASE-Trainee | Training Period | ₹3.2 – ₹3.8 |
C1Y | Assistant Systems Engineer | 0-2 years | ₹3.8 – ₹5.5 |
C1 | Systems Engineer | 2-4 years | ₹5.5 – ₹8.0 |
C2 | IT Analyst | 4-7 years | ₹8.0 – ₹15.0 |
C3A | Assistant Consultant | 7-10 years | ₹15.0 – ₹25.0 |
C3B | Consultant | 10+ years | ₹25.0 – ₹40.0 |

TCS Salary for Freshers: Your Starting Point
What is the starting salary offered by TCS for B.Tech graduates? Fresh graduates joining TCS can expect a starting package ranging from ₹3.2 to ₹3.8 lakhs per annum, depending on their academic performance and the specific program they join.
Fresher Salary Breakdown
TCS salary for freshers per month typically includes:
Component | Amount (₹) | Percentage |
---|---|---|
Base Salary | 20,000 – 25,000 | 70% |
HRA | 6,000 – 8,000 | 20% |
Special Allowance | 2,000 – 3,000 | 7% |
Other Benefits | 1,000 – 1,500 | 3% |

Onsite Opportunities and Salary Calculations
How onsite salary is calculated in TCS involves multiple components:
Onsite Salary Structure
Component | Calculation Method |
---|---|
Base Salary | India salary converted at current exchange rate |
Per Diem | Daily allowance for living expenses |
Accommodation | Company-provided or reimbursed |
Health Insurance | Enhanced coverage |
Travel Allowance | Annual trips to India |
Typical onsite salary multiplier: 2.5x to 3x of India salary, depending on the country and project duration.
Variable Pay and Bonus Structure
While salary hikes are on hold, TCS continues with quarterly variable payouts. For Q4, 70% of employees received 100% of their variable pay, while for the rest, it depends on business performance.
TCS Variable Pay Breakdown
Performance Rating | Variable Pay % |
---|---|
Exceeds Expectations | 100% |
Meets Expectations | 80-100% |
Partially Meets | 60-80% |
Below Expectations | 0-60% |
TCS salary variable pay cut has been a concern, but the company maintains that performance-linked payouts continue as scheduled.

Career Progression and Grade Transitions
Understanding grade progression is crucial for salary growth:
Typical Promotion Timeline
From Grade | To Grade | Average Time | Salary Increase |
---|---|---|---|
Y to C1Y | C1Y | 6-12 months | 15-25% |
C1Y to C1 | C1 | 2 years | 20-30% |
C1 to C2 | C2 | 2-3 years | 25-35% |
C2 to C3A | C3A | 3-4 years | 30-50% |
What is the salary of C1 grade in TCS? C1 grade employees typically earn between ₹5.5 to ₹8.0 lakhs per annum, depending on experience and performance.
What is the salary of C3A grade in TCS? C3A grade professionals can expect salaries ranging from ₹15.0 to ₹25.0 lakhs per annum.
TCS Salary Hike Trends and Future Outlook
Historical salary hike patterns reveal interesting insights:
Year-over-Year Hike Comparison
Year | Average Hike % | Market Conditions |
---|---|---|
FY22 | 10.5% | Post-pandemic recovery |
FY23 | 6-9% | Market stabilization |
FY24 | 7-9% | Steady growth |
FY25 | 4-8% (Deferred) | Economic uncertainty |
TCS salary hikes fy26 are expected to normalize as global economic conditions stabilize.

The Reality of TCS Layoffs and Restructuring
TCS is in the middle of a large workforce restructuring, which will see around 2% of its global staff, primarily mid- and senior-level roles, exiting the company over the course of 2025, roughly amounting to 12,000 jobs.
This restructuring aims to make TCS a “future-ready” enterprise, focusing on:
- Emerging technologies
- Client-centric roles
- High-performance individuals
- Strategic skill sets
